Outclassed is more a word. Mike started clowning in the 3rd because I guess he thought he had Holt figured out. Then Holt started hitting him and started clowning him. The 5th round was the best of the fight. It was tactical but in the 5th round Holt did start clowning Mike, putting his hands at his waist and sticking his chin out and when Mike tried to hit him holt pulled back and hit him with a straight right hand. It got to a point where his corner told him to "Have fun but still be respectful" because he was really making Mike look badOriginally Posted by El Gamo
